Pros & cons summary


Recency on April 2025 11 August 2025
Maximum RAM amount 8 GB 24 GB
Power consumption (TDP) 50 Watt 70 Watt

RTX 5070 Mobile has 40% lower power consumption.

RTX PRO 4000 Blackwell SFF, on the other hand, has an age advantage of 4 months, and a 200% higher maximum VRAM amount.

We couldn't decide between GeForce RTX 5070 Mobile and RTX PRO 4000 Blackwell SFF. We've got no test results to judge.

Be aware that GeForce RTX 5070 Mobile is a notebook graphics card while RTX PRO 4000 Blackwell SFF is a workstation one.
